Job Description /Preferred QualificationsThe Cloud Platform Engineer will build, automate, secure, and operate cloud-based platform solutions across multiple cloud platforms - GCP, Azure, and AWS, with GCP and Azure as the preferred focus. This role requires a strong, practical understanding of cloud security, identity and access management, networking, and secure-by-design principles, in addition to IaaS and PaaS best practices.
Responsibilities:Build scalable, resilient, and secure cloud platforms on IaaS/PaaS across GCP, Azure, and AWS (focus on GCP and Azure).
Execute cloud migrations - re-host, re-platform, refactor, and re-architect - with automation and security posture improvement.
Drive application and infrastructure modernization for scalability, performance, and efficiency.
Partner with engineering and security teams to implement reference architectures, reusable modules, and security guardrails.
Optimize infrastructure for performance, reliability, security hardening, and cost efficiency.
Implement and maintain cloud security controls and governance guardrails aligned with industry standards.
Build secure cloud networking, including VPN, Cloud Interconnect, Express Route, and Direct Connect.
Configure network segmentation, micro-segmentation, and zero-trust controls.
Secure and operate containers, Kubernetes (GKE/AKS/EKS), serverless, and microservices
Develop Infrastructure as Code with Terraform (primary), plus Azure Bicep/ARM, Google Config Connector, and AWS Cloud Formation.
Build Dev Sec Ops CI/CD pipelines with integrated security scanning, policy enforcement, and compliance validation.
Implement observability - logging, monitoring, alerting, and incident response integration.
Evaluate emerging cloud and automation technologies to improve reliability, security, and resilience.
Create platform documentation, runbooks, and architecture/security diagrams.
